Nyanya Bomb Blast

Another bomb blast in Abuja...This time in Nyanya in Karu Local Government Area Nigeria.
Eye witness accounts say casualties are at about 200 corpses and still counting but can’t confirm the exact figures. The incident is said to have occurred at about 6:15am during early morning hour. Fire Service, NSCDC officials, the DSS, NEMA, and Police have been on ground battling to contain the situation.
One of the victims at Nyanya Park,said that he was on a queue to get on a bus when he and other passengers heard a loud blast and scampered to safety. Different control agencies have been at the scene to control the situation. “Yes the situation is exactly what you are seeing on ground, there has been an explosion of high magnitude and several lives have been lost, even as you are looking on the ground you’ll see patches of human flesh" a  DSS official said. It is a suspicion that it was a bomb placed on the ground.

 
On the casualty level, over 7 to 8 vehicles, from NEMA, Civil Defence, and other agencies who have done evacuations has been recorded to have carried people corpses. At least 30 vehicles have been destroyed including 7 Abuja BTR buses also known as El-Rufia bus. So far, no group has claim to have committed this attrocity.
